A hospital stay can be a terrifying experience for a child - especially those with cancer and other life-changing illnesses. Recent research indicates 20% of children who are hospitalized with cancer and 30% of their mothers suffer full symptoms of post-traumatic stress disorder (Ptsd). These rates are comparable to that experienced by u.s. War veterans serving since the vietnam war. The good news is trauma can be minimized and outcomes improved through experiences that reduce stress. The organization was founded in 2007 to bring comfort and support to young patients and their families in hospitals around the globe. We started with a simple goal: to create and distribute whimsical pillowcases that give children an emotional boost and remind them that they are not defined by their illness. Today, our programs have expanded to include the children's entire families so they can better navigate and cope with a very difficult experience and avoid long term emotional drama.
